English Sterling Silver Tiger Sculpture - Edward Barnard & Sons, London, 1975
Artist: Edward Barnard & Sons
A finely modelled sterling silver (unweighted) sculpture of a walking tiger, the elongated body crisply chased throughout to render the striped coat and muscular form, mouth open in a snarl, long tail curling behind.
A realistic and dynamic study in the great tradition of animalier silver, by Edward Barnard & Sons Ltd.
Lion Passant silver hallmark for England
French swan hallmark control
Leopard’s head hallmark for the City of London
Date letter A for 1975
Length: 51 cm
Width: 9 cm
Height: 20.5 cm
Weight: 3440 grams
